The Department of Philosophy invites applications for a one-year, full-time, leave replacement position beginning August, 2012. Areas of Specialization: Open. Areas of Competence: Ethics and at least one period in the history of philosophy. The successful applicant should be conversant with the analytic tradition in philosophy and be prepared to teach our introductory Ethics, Justice, and Society course, which focuses on ethical and political thought from Plato through Rousseau. Responsibilities include teaching five undergraduate courses and advising five senior research projects in the College’s Independent Study Program. A PhD is required, but ABD will be considered if completion of doctorate is expected by August 2012.
Send application letter, curriculum vitae, names of three references, brief writing sample, and evidence of teaching experience electronically to Patrice Reeder. Materials submitted by 1/17/2012 will receive full consideration.
